Story

Patrick Jane and the California Bureau of Investigation take on the murder of Gordon Hodge, a powerful attorney whose professional decisions helped a dangerous killer, Van McBride, escape justice. The case forces Jane to examine more than the circumstances of Hodge's death. Every witness may be hiding a motive, and the connection to a man who once walked free gives the investigation a troubling moral edge.

Jane approaches the crime with his usual disregard for protocol, relying on sharp observation, psychological insight, and an ability to notice details that others overlook. As the team works through conflicting accounts and buried resentment, the investigation becomes a test of how far guilt can reach beyond the person who committed the original crime.

Overview

This crime drama episode of The Mentalist follows Patrick Jane, a former celebrity psychic medium who now consults for the California Bureau of Investigation. His claims of supernatural ability have given way to close observation and expert people-reading, allowing him to expose contradictions that conventional investigative methods may miss.

The episode combines a focused murder inquiry with the continuing tensions inside the CBI. Jane's independence often clashes with official procedure, while the team's professional loyalties are complicated by personal histories and relationships. The result is a measured detective story shaped by psychological pressure, questions of accountability, and the uneasy boundary between justice and revenge.
